Kohima Police's official website launched

Joining the digital world, the official website of Kohima Police was launched today by Nagaland DGP, L L Doungel, IPS.
The web portal www.Kohimapolice.Com. Kohima is the second district of Nagaland after Dimapur Police Commissionerate having it's own police website, which was launched in November last year.
The DGP said the official website would add as a force multiplier and also help the public to reach the police without any hesitations.
Besides the contact details of every police stations, traffic control and women cell within the district the website also contains information for public services.
